Hi Rajiv..,
Instaed of passing complete URL like : ormi://localhost:23791
just give URL as like localhost:23791
because Toplink API getting first index of ":" and treating second portion as port, which results converting following string into int //localhost:23791 is not possible.., so it is throwing numberformat exception.,

}Since you're using EJBs, you can use JTA and can skip the getTransaction() calls. If you want to use getTransaction().begin() and commit(), then make sure that your EntityManager is resource-local. The configuration for this is in persistence.xml. Set a transaction-type of RESOURCE_LOCAL rather than JTA.

DipuThis is one of the "classic" design problems in this kind of architecture. And, unfortunately, the answer is "it depends on how you think you need to handle it." And I'm sure there are plenty of "gurus" that will tell you one way or another is the only way to do it.
I'll be more honest: I'll give you a couple of personal suggestions, based on experience in this architecture. These are suggestions - you may do with them what you will. I will not say this is the best, most correct, or even remotely relevant to what you're doing.
If it's simple data validation for "typing" (e.g. String, number, Date, etc.), that is taken care of when you attempt to stuff in the information into the appropriate DTO. If it's more "sophisticated" than that (must be in a certain range, etc.), that particular checking should probably be delegated from your Controller to a helper class. That not only saves the "expense" of transmitting the information back and forth across the wire, it's "faster" to the end user so say "Ooopsie" by redirecting back to the form right then. Basically the same thing if the types are wrong.
That only leaves the "big" problems in the business layer (EJBs), where you have to deal with concurrency, database failures, etc. Generally these kinds of exceptions are thrown back to to the Controller in one of two forms:
1) a sublass of RuntimeException, which signals that some Very Bad Things have happened in your container. EJBException is one like that and you can see where it's being thrown from.
2) a subclass of Exception, also called "application exceptions." They are usually something like a "duplicate record" or a validation-like error (which you mentioned) like a missing field. They're used as a signal to a failure in the logic, not the container. That way you have to decide at what layer of your architecture they should be handled and/or passed on to the next. -
